Software Engineer - Senior

US-AZ-Fort Huachuca

NCI Information Systems Inc.

Req #: 7468
Type: Regular Full-Time
logo

NCI Information Systems Inc.

Connect With Us:
Connect To Our Company
				Overview:

Empower AI is AI for government. Empower AI gives federal agency leaders the tools to elevate the potential of their workforce with a direct path for meaningful transformation. Headquartered in Reston, Va., Empower AI leverages three decades of experience solving complex challenges in Health, Defense, and Civilian missions. Our proven Empower AI Platform(r) provides a practical, sustainable path for clients to achieve transformation that is true to who they are, what they do, how they work, with the resources they have. The result is a government workforce that is exponentially more creative and productive. For more information, visit www.Empower.ai.

Empower AI is proud to be recognized as a 2022 Military Friendly Employer by Viqtory, the publisher of G.I. Jobs. This designation reflects the company's commitment to hiring and supporting active-duty and veteran employees. 

Responsibilities:

ESSENTIAL FUNCTIONS BY LEVEL:

* Responsible for the design, coding, testing and validation of programs that solve engineering related problems.
* Reviews and tests software components for adherence to the design requirements and documents test results.
* Utilizes software development and software design methodologies appropriate to the development environment.
* Analyzes user requirements to derive software design and performance requirements.
* Designs and codes new software or modifies existing software to add new features; debugs existing software and corrects defects.
* Integrates existing software into new or modifies systems or operating environments.
* Works closely with end-users and/or internal project teams to develop detailed technical requirements and specifications for the development of the software element for complex systems.
* Directs the development of the architecture, detailed system design, coding, integration, testing and configuration management schemes for software systems.
* Prepares program and test specifications.
* Prepares test procedures and data.
* Provides technical direction, guidance, and assistance to assigned projects, suggesting efficient approaches and methods for solving problems.

Qualifications:

MINIMUM REQUIREMENTS:

* Bachelor's Degree in Computer Science or equivalent related experience
* ITIL v4
* IAT Level II Certifcate 

EXPERIENCE REQUIRED BY LEVEL:

* IV: 7 - 12 Years 

PREFERRED EDUCATION AND EXPERIENCE:

* SQL
* Metalogiz Suite
* ACAS 

PHYSICAL REQUIREMENTS:

This position requires the ability to perform the below essential functions:

* Sitting for long periods
* Standing for long periods
* Ambulate throughout an office
* Ambulate between several buildings
* Stoop, kneel, crouch, or crawl as required
* Repeatedly lift and carry weight up to 25 pounds
* Travel by land or air transportation 15%
			
Share this job: